已经R0=8000,R1=8800,执行指令MOV R0,R1,LSR#2后,R0=【53】,R1=【54】。

admin2021-06-09  13

问题 已经R0=8000,R1=8800,执行指令MOV R0,R1,LSR#2后,R0=【53】,R1=【54】。

选项

答案【53】2200【54】8800

解析   本题考查MOV指令和移位操作指令的使用。MOV R0,R1,LSR#2表示将R1中的内容右移两位后送到R0中,左端用0来填充。8800的二进制为1000100000000000,右移两位后变为0010001000000000,即为2200。R1保持不变。
转载请注明原文地址:https://kaotiyun.com/show/pD0Z777K
0

最新回复(0)